    Stay far, far away…read more On 5-14-2018, I arrived for my PT appointment at PT Solutions Physical Therapy at the recommendation of my family doctor. I had been in pain with a sciatica nerve problem. This was my first appointment and I arrived early to complete the paperwork. It was explained to me that as I had not met my insurance deductible, I would have to pay for the appointment. I paid $106.64 at the front desk before starting any therapy. My PT consisted of a few questions, a bit of trigger point pressing that sent my left leg into more pain. The trigger point pressing was also uncomfortable as it was well below my belt line and the therapist went under my clothing without first asking. Finally, I rolled a big ball with my legs while laying on my back. There was one therapist who seemed in charge and one that seemed to be in training. There were three other patients in the one-room facility. The two of them were moving back and forth between the four of us. I was there less than one hour and my actual therapy was less than about 30 minutes. A few weeks go by and I receive an itemized statement from Wellstar. The total bill for my visit was $751.00. Yes - you read that correctly, $751.00. Subtract what I believed to have been my full payment of $106.64, this leaves me with a balance of $644.36 to pay Wellstar, for ONE VISIT. There was never an explanation that I would be billed further for treatment. Several phone calls have been placed to PT Solutions and to Wellstar accounts. It seems that because I went in under my insurance, not having met my deductible, I am responsible for the ridiculous charges. Wellstar explained that IF I had been a walk-in, my total cost would have been about $160. Seriously??? I have since been going to another PT establishment for numerous visits working through my sciatica pain. I pay $35 per visit, NOTHING MORE. PT Solutions and Wellstar are not interested in what other facilities charge for fair and equitable treatment. The accounts Manager at Wellstar said that there is nothing he can do to eliminate the remaining charges. I do not believe the services which I received and am responsible for entirely is worth the total amount of $751.00, under any circumstance. As such, we will be contacting the BBB and Town of Tyrone officials to enlighten them on what we believe is unfair pricing as well as lack of customer service. I accept the responsibility to pay and, will do so, however, I believe that anyone considering PT Solutions should think twice and ask lots of questions concerning their billing practices and lack of transparency pertaining to them. Also understand that this facility is more like a mill. There is no privacy in the one large open room. Your time with the therapist is not a one-on-one appointment and, you may be put into an uncomfortable situation.
